Climate Overview

The climate in Néa Mádytos is temperate. The average annual temperature is 16°C and approximately 650mm of precipitation falls per year. March is the wettest month, receiving around 88mm of rainfall. Néa Mádytos is in the Northern Hemisphere. Summer begins at the end of June and lasts through September. The summer months are: August, July, June. The coldest months are January, December, February, when temperatures can drop to 1°C. Light snow can occur between January and March.

Temperatures in Néa Mádytos vary considerably across the year, with a 34°C difference between the coldest and warmest months. The warmest month is August, when average highs reach 35°C and the mean temperature sits around 28°C. January is the coolest month, with minimum temperatures around 1°C and an average of 5°C. On average, daily temperatures fluctuate by about 11°C between overnight lows and afternoon highs. The sharpest temperature change occurs between September and October, with a 6°C shift in average temperatures.

Néa Mádytos is a relatively dry area, receiving approximately 650mm of precipitation annually, which averages out to around 54mm per month. The wettest month is March, averaging 88mm of rainfall. November and June also tend to see above-average precipitation. The driest month is August, with just 27mm. That's 61mm less than March, the wettest month. Precipitation varies noticeably between seasons, with the first half (January to June) of the year generally seeing more rainfall. Light snowfall can occur between January and March, totalling around 12cm annually. January is the snowiest month with approximately 6cm.

Néa Mádytos is relatively calm, with an average annual wind speed of 10km/h. For context, sustained winds below 12km/h are generally light, while anything above 25km/h is considered strong. The windiest month is April, averaging 11km/h, though still comfortable for most outdoor activities. The calmest conditions occur in October, with average winds dropping to 8km/h, making it an ideal period for wind-sensitive activities. Wind conditions are fairly consistent throughout the year, varying by only 3km/h between the calmest and windiest months.
